December 7 Showdown: Be yourself—Joshua advised ahead Ruiz Jr rematch

Anthony Joshua has been told to be himself to beat against Andy Ruiz Jr in next weekend’s world title rematch in Saudi Arabia.

Joshua lost his belts to Ruiz in June

That’s the verdict of former world champion John Conteh, who said the British fighter should stop worrying about “playing catch-up”.

“He does it well. I feel he’s a natural fighter, becoming an Olympic champion and a world champion after starting at 17.

“But I always feel he looks like he’s catching up. He’s going against fighters now who won’t allow him, at that level, to catch-up.

“In my opinion, he doesn’t need to anyway. He’s there, and I always say, whatever got him to where he is, from when he first started in Watford to becoming a world champion, you want to go back to that,” he said.

Joshua has been criticised for his lack of natural boxing pedigree in the past having taken up the sport aged 17 and rapidly risen through the ranks.
